Moacir Kripka is a scholar working on Civil and Structural Engineering, Building and Construction and Environmental Engineering. According to data from OpenAlex, Moacir Kripka has authored 55 papers receiving a total of 511 ind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Civil and Structural Engineering, 29 papers in Building and Construction and 7 papers in Environmental Engineering. Recurrent topics in Moacir Kripka's work include Recycled Aggregate Concrete Performance (11 papers), Topology Optimization in Engineering (11 papers) and Concrete Corrosion and Durability (11 papers). Moacir Kripka is often cited by papers focused on Recycled Aggregate Concrete Performance (11 papers), Topology Optimization in Engineering (11 papers) and Concrete Corrosion and Durability (11 papers). Moacir Kripka collaborates with scholars based in Brazil, Spain and United States. Moacir Kripka's co-authors include Víctor Yepes, Afonso Celso de Castro Lemonge, Tayfun Dede, Julián Alcalà, A.R. Vosoughi, Murat Kankal, R. Venkata Rao and Vedat Toğan and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and Energy and Buildings.
